4177 – πολίτης (polites)

citizen


Type:
Noun
mask.
Greek: πολίτης (polites)
Pronunciation: pol-ee-tace
Gematria: 504(80 + 70 + 30 + 10 + 300 + 8 + 6)    words with the same gematria
Origin: From G4172
Usage: 4 times in NA, 3 times in TR     

Description

  1. A citizen.
    1. The inhabitant of any city or country.
    2. The association of another in citizenship.
      1. A fellow citizen, fellow countryman.


Origin

From G4172:
